Tencent Bets Big: Yuanbao App to Hand Out 1 Billion Yuan for Lunar New Year
Tencent Doubles Down on AI With Massive Spring Festival Giveaway
At Tencent's annual gathering today, chairman Ma Huateng dropped what might be the biggest Lunar New Year surprise package yet. The tech giant plans to shower users with 1 billion yuan ($140 million) in cash rewards through its AI application Yuanbao during the upcoming Spring Festival season.
Red Envelope Strategy Reloaded
The promotion, kicking off February 1st, will allow individuals to pocket up to 10,000 yuan ($1,400) each. This bold move clearly aims to recapture the magic of WeChat's revolutionary red envelope campaign that took China by storm in 2015.
"We're bringing back that festive excitement," Ma hinted during his announcement, "but with an AI-powered twist."
Introducing Yuanbao Party: Where AI Meets Socializing
The real showstopper was Ma's revelation of Yuanbao Party, Tencent's previously hush-hush social AI project. This innovative feature represents the company's first serious foray into blending artificial intelligence with its core social networking strengths.
Imagine this: Your group chat gets smarter overnight. Yuanbao Party introduces:
- AI moderators that summarize conversations and nudge friends about fitness goals
- Meme generators that create inside jokes on demand
- Shared entertainment hubs powered by Tencent Meeting's technology
The feature integrates seamlessly with WeChat and QQ, allowing instant sharing between platforms. It's social networking - just not as we've known it.
Why This Matters Now
Tencent appears determined to solve AI's biggest challenge: keeping users engaged beyond initial novelty. By combining:
- Massive financial incentives (that billion-yuan carrot)
- Deep social integration (their home turf advantage)
- Practical daily-use features (from fitness tracking to meme creation)
they're positioning Yuanbao as more than another chatbot - it wants to be your digital social glue.
The Spring Festival timing isn't accidental either. As families gather and red envelopes fly, Tencent hopes its AI assistant will become part of those precious reunion moments.
